Needle pattern reconstruction is a service that modifies the needle boards and beams of a needle loom, changing or increasing the needle pattern and density so the machine can make a new product or application. Needle looms are designed for a specific product or product group, so as needs change over time, reconstructing the pattern upgrades the machine economically instead of buying a new one. The benefits include reduced needle breakage, higher output, better fabric quality and a customized needle pattern.
